>>> This and your previous post indicate to me that you built ntp without
>>> support from OpenSSL.
>>
>> ... which means the OpenSSL header files must be installed on your
>> system, so NTP's ./configure script will be able to detect them and the
>> NTP binaries can be built with OpenSSL support.
>
> The OP is using RedHat.
>
> While I'm not familiar with that particular OS I can tell you that on
> Debian it takes one command to set up the correct build environment for
> NTP:
>
> # apt-get build-deps ntp
